Donald Trump’s projected win in the 2024 election could pose challenges for high-skilled immigrants, particularly H-1B visa holders. Donald Trump’s projected victory in the 2024 presidential election may signal a tough road ahead for high-skilled immigrants, especially those on H-1B visas and their families. While Trump has floated the idea of “stapling a green card” to “international students”, his prior administration’s record suggests stricter immigration measures are more likely. During his first term, Trump oversaw a substantial increase in H-1B visa denials and Requests for Evidence (RFEs), leading to heightened uncertainty for high-skilled workers. Supreme Court underlined the UP government’s vital role in ensuring that educational standards in madrasas align with modern academic expectations. The Supreme Court on Tuesday set aside the Allahabad high court’s March judgment that declared the 2004 Uttar Pradesh Board of Madarsa Education Act unconstitutional. Simultaneously, a bench comprising Chief Justice of India (CJI) DY Chandrachud and Justices JB Pardiwala and Manoj Misra underlined the Uttar Pradesh government’s vital role in ensuring that educational standards in madrasas align with modern academic expectations, asking the state to relocate students to other schools.
